#asp.net-mvc #visual-studio #iis-express
#asp.net-mvc #visual-studio #iis-express
Вопрос:
Я создал ASP.NET Проект веб-приложения. Когда я нажимаю кнопку «IIS express» в Visual Studio, я получаю следующее в браузере:
Доступ запрещен.
Описание: Произошла ошибка при доступе к ресурсам, необходимым для обслуживания этого запроса. Возможно, у вас нет разрешения на просмотр запрошенных ресурсов.
Сообщение об ошибке 401.3: у вас нет разрешения на просмотр этого каталога или страницы с использованием предоставленных вами учетных данных (доступ запрещен из-за списков контроля доступа). Попросите администратора веб-сервера предоставить вам доступ к ‘H:mypath «.
Если я перемещу свой проект куда-нибудь на C:, тогда все будет работать так, как ожидалось.
H: сопоставляется с общим ресурсом samba на хосте Linux. Я полагаю, что ожидается, что IIS express будет запускаться от имени текущего пользователя при таком запуске, поэтому в этом случае учетные данные samba не должны быть проблемой.
Итак … как мне решить эту проблему?
Комментарии:
1. Насколько я понимаю, IIS Express не поддерживает подключенные диски.
2. Я предполагаю, что тогда мне придется клонировать свой проект на c: вместо этого. (Это не большая проблема, за исключением того, что мне нужно не забывать делать резервные копии вручную.)